What You Can Expect from the Tour
This 4-hour adventure is designed to be both exciting and scenic. The core activity is about 70 minutes of quad driving on a rugged mountain track that combines rocky, dusty paths with wet and muddy sections. The terrain is intentionally challenging, adding that extra thrill for those who enjoy an off-road challenge.
The tour begins with hotel pickup in Bodrum, making it straightforward to join without worrying about transportation. Once you’re at the base station, professional guides will give an essential safety briefing and instructions. A common theme in recent reviews is the messy nature of the activity. Muddy, wet, and dusty trails mean you’ll probably get dirty — a badge of honor, really, for outdoor adventurers. Bring comfortable clothes and shoes to handle the dirt.
One reviewer pointed out that upon arrival, participants are expected to buy additional items like bandanas and sunglasses, with photos also being overpriced. So, if you’re not prepared for potential extra costs, you might want to bring your own gear or be ready for the additional expenses.

Is It Worth the Price?

At $51 per person, considering the full guidance, insurance, and hotel pickup, it’s a solid value for a half-day adventure. The inclusion of transportation and instructor support makes it hassle-free, which is often the biggest selling point for busy travelers.
However, be mindful of the extra costs some participants faced — for bandanas, sunglasses, or additional photos. It’s worth planning ahead or clarifying what’s included to avoid surprises.
Practical Tips for Booking and Enjoying

- Wear comfortable clothes and shoes suitable for getting dirty.
- Be on time for pickup — the guides usually wait only 5 minutes after the scheduled time.
- Listen carefully during the safety briefing—your guides are there to help you enjoy the ride safely.
- If you’re bringing kids, double-check with the provider whether they can ride as passengers or if they qualify to drive.
- Consider bringing your own gear to avoid extra charges for accessories like bandanas or sunglasses.
- Prepare for a messy experience — pack an extra shirt or change of clothes if you want to clean up afterward.

FAQ
Is hotel pickup included in the tour?
Yes, the tour offers free hotel pickup from all Bodrum hotels, with guides waiting at the main security gate of your hotel. Be sure to wait 10 minutes before your scheduled pickup time.
Can I drive if I am under 18?
No, drivers under 18 are not allowed to drive the quad bike. If you’re under 18, you might be able to ride as a passenger, but it’s best to confirm with the provider.
What should I wear for the activity?
Wear comfortable shoes and clothes that you don’t mind getting dirty. Long pants and closed shoes are recommended to protect your skin.
Are there any additional costs I should be aware of?
Some reviews mention extra expenses for bandanas, sunglasses, and photos. The tour price includes insurance and guiding, but be prepared for optional extras.
How long does the activity last?
The entire experience lasts about 4 hours, with 70 minutes of quad riding included. The actual driving is about two hours, with time allocated for pickup and drop-off.
Is this experience suitable for families?
It’s suitable for most ages, but only those over 18 can drive. Young children or families with younger kids should check if riding as a passenger is an option.
What is the terrain like?
The trail is dusty, rocky, wet, and muddy, offering a lively off-road experience. Expect to get dirty, which adds to the fun if you’re prepared.
